Meet Waterloo’s 10 new Schulich Leaders
The 2025 cohort represents some of the brightest new entrepreneurial minds in STEM
The University of Waterloo is pleased to welcome 10 outstanding students to its incoming first-year class through the prestigious Schulich Leader Scholarships program.
Awarded annually to 100 high school graduates across Canada, these scholarships recognize exceptional individuals who demonstrate strong entrepreneurial potential in science, technology, engineering and mathematics (STEM). Each Schulich Leader receives between $100,000 and $120,000, empowering them to pursue their academic goals with financial peace of mind.
Since 2012, nearly 90 Schulich Leaders have chosen Waterloo as the launchpad for their academic and professional journeys.

Fiona Cai | Computer Science

A dedicated mathematician, she qualified for the Math Prize for Girls at MIT, was president of her school’s math club, and led her school team to top finishes in international competitions.
Cai is currently interested in the intersection of human-computer interaction and machine learning and has her eyes set on building technology that empowers others. After graduation, she hopes to draw on her problem-solving skills to develop technologies that push boundaries and make tangible impacts.
“I can’t wait to get involved once I’m on campus … I think being in an environment where everyone is constantly building will be incredibly inspiring,” she says.
Kaibo Huang | Software Engineering

In May 2025, he joined Electrium Mobility — a Waterloo design team — where he has been helping build Electriumap, an app that helps users locate nearby outlets and stay connected to green energy. “I’ve really enjoyed collaborating with upper-year Waterloo students over the summer, and I look forward to taking on a larger leadership role within the team,” he says.
At Waterloo, Kaibo hopes to build on the skills he developed in high school and push beyond his comfort zone. “I enjoy uncertainty, taking unconventional paths and learning from as many people as I can” he says. He chose to pursue a Software Engineering degree because of its broad curriculum covering math, physics, computer science and hardware, with hopes of one day working with machine learning and data.
Michelle Jeon | Computer Science

“I chose the University of Waterloo because it felt like the launchpad for the future I want to build,” she says. “The Computer Science program is where I believe I could easily explore how things work under the hood, while also thinking about the impact it leaves on users.”
For this reason, Jeon aspires to use technology as a force for social impact by building tools that will make for a healthier future.
One of her proudest achievements to date was seeing her grandfather, who is deaf, use the app she developed to aid deaf individuals with communication. “Seeing something I built make a difference in the life of someone I love was a full circle moment,” she shares.

Azka Siddiqui | Computer Engineering

While completing an internship with Nokia last summer, Siddiqui developed solutions on the Fault Management team including refining an advanced filter tool that displayed data from more than 10,000 alarms. She has also contributed to university research developing smart-grid anomaly detection algorithms using federated learning, receiving the NCWIT Aspirations in Computing award for her work.
At Waterloo, Siddiqui looks forward to being part of Waterloo’s startup and innovation ecosystem. “Being able to live on campus because of this scholarship puts me in a much better place to learn, collaborate and build,” she says.
Long-term, she hopes to launch a health-tech startup harnessing computer vision to design smart diagnostic devices, combining her technical expertise with her drive to create technology for social good.

Sean Zhang | Computer Science

“Even before receiving this prestigious scholarship, Waterloo was always my top choice,” he says. Zhang is eager to begin his studies and take advantage of an environment that balances academics with real-world experience. He’s especially excited to meet other students who share his energy, drive and passion for building and lifelong learning. “Whether it's in class, at a co-op job, or through a side project, I’m excited to learn from those around me and grow together.”
Aside from his tech interests, Zhang is also a competitive swimmer and founded his high school’s varsity swim team that went on to break regional records within its first year. Starting this fall, he will be joining the Waterloo Warriors and looks forward to continuing his swimming career under coach Jacky Beckford-Henriques.
